POLYWOOD® is looking for a hands-on Cost Controller who thrives in a fast-paced manufacturing environment. In this highly visible role, you’ll lead the charge in driving cost transparency, developing robust plant reporting systems, and influencing business decisions with data. You’ll play a critical role in implementing and managing a comprehensive standard costing system, while also supporting plant operations and corporate leadership with clear, actionable financial insights. If you're someone who enjoys solving operational puzzles, building dashboards, and partnering across teams to elevate performance—this is the opportunity for you.

  • Design and implement standard costing across materials, labor, and overhead
  • Conduct BOM reviews, validate routings, and establish allocation models
  • Reconcile variances between standard and actual costs including usage, efficiency, and absorption
  • Partner with supply chain, engineering, and production to maintain accurate cost drivers
  • Manage metric reporting, budgeting, and monthly variance analysis
  • Deliver clear financial commentary and forecasts to plant and corporate leadership
  • Oversee inventory valuation, cycle counts, and physical inventory processes
  • Support capital expenditure tracking and return on investment analysis
  • Develop KPIs for throughput, OEE, downtime, scrap, and cost per unit
  • Build dashboards and scorecards that promote visibility and accountability
  • Provide insights that drive continuous improvement and cost reductions
  • Maintain internal controls around inventory, labor, and spending
  • Support compliance with GAAP, internal audits, and reporting requirements
  • Document financial workflows to ensure consistency and scalability
  • Serve as a financial partner to the Plant Manager and other operations leaders
  • Coordinate with IT, Engineering, and HR to ensure system alignment and data integrity
  • Assist with ERP optimization and automated reporting initiatives
